Output 2a384aef43c87459275e0ff3e60c32785bb13f51a11a66a3b962066e279209c3:6

value
4777268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f966bcc456435cef626eebdfcbb300e26dedb70 OP_EQUAL
address
3EnEkR4syjpXTyKksqXtipUq6657nqfcsz
transaction
2a384aef43c87459275e0ff3e60c32785bb13f51a11a66a3b962066e279209c3
confirmations
153336
spent
true